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2998619 58570 23046409401 270829624
84500123 46
84500123 46
77285552335 861343 520 79
All about undefined
Interested in learning more?
84500123 46
77285552335 861343 520 79
See more
3308813 790078
14538401 163 02252662 30
See more
535134652 83047349 16
97859 9655746599 8460712287 9507
See more